Solar energy technology in a pv container uses photovoltaic panels to make electricity from sunlight. These panels are on the roof or sides of the container. It works even in far away outdoor places. Market data says outdoor mobile power solutions. . A photovoltaic container is a self-contained solar energy system built inside a durable shipping container. These types of containers involve photovoltaic (PV) panels, battery storage systems, inverters, and smart controllers—all housed in a structure that can be shipped to remote. .
